Rollin' Down the River: Exploring the Mighty Missouri

In 2016, Larry Campbell spent seven weeks following the Missouri River by car from its (official) source in Three Forks, MT to where it empties into the Mississippi River near St. Louis. Pictures, stories, history, scenery, and people - all are built into this armchair-traveler presentation.
